Kettler Enterprises, Inc. (KETTLER) is hiring a Central Business Manager to serve as a key leader in executing our Central Business Office strategy. This strategic role oversees centralized community responsibilities to enhance productivity and operational efficiency across an assigned portfolio of multi-family properties, focusing on financial operations and lease management.
What You'll Do
- Partner with the Director and stakeholders to implement the Central Business Office (CBO) strategy.
- Work remotely to efficiently deliver centralized community responsibilities.
- Perform Yardi input, timely rent collection batch postings, manage delinquencies, handle daily banking deposits, prepare collection documents, contact residents for overdue rent, complete legal filings, make court appearances, and escalate accounts to collections.
- Conduct weekly, monthly, and quarterly financial reviews to assess delinquency and collections success.
- Participate in client calls to report progress on CBO responsibilities.
- Assist in meeting revenue goals by contributing to occupancy targets, ancillary income, resident retention, and monitoring financial performance against budget.
- Complete resident security deposit accounting, manage refunds, and follow up on balances due.
- Handle all administrative functions, ensuring accurate and timely end-of-month reporting for A/R, A/P, and variance reports.
- Manage other lease responsibilities, including alterations, renewals, and affordable housing re-certifications.
